Цифрові шептуни: як ваш штучний інтелект стає справжнім помічником
Здавалося б, технології живуть власним життям. Працюєш над завданням, а комп’ютер чи телефон раптом видає варіант, ніби читає твої думки. Іноді це дратує, але частіше дивує. Особливо, коли йдеться про штучний інтелект. Пам’ятаю, як мій друг, розробник, зізнався: “Ліло, я й сам не завжди розумію, як ці агенти спілкуються між собою. Це як мурашник, тільки замість мурах – код, а замість тунелів – мережа”.
Це змусило мене замислитися. Ми звикли вважати ШІ чимось монолітним, однією великою розумною машиною. А що, як сучасний штучний інтелект – це не один монстр, а команда спеціалістів, кожен з яких знає свою справу? І якщо вони ще й здатні спілкуватися, координувати дії для виконання масштабних завдань? Звучить як наукова фантастика, але це вже реальність.
Уявіть, що можете доручити своєму ШІ написати десятки персоналізованих подяк для колег, які допомогли з важливим проєктом. Не просто надіслати шаблон, а зробити так, щоб кожна подяка звучала щиро, враховувала внесок кожної людини, і все це – поки ви смакуєте ранкову каву. Як це можливо? Сьогодні ми зануримось під капот цих дивовижних цифрових помічників і дізнаємось секрет їхньої співпраці. Готові? Поїхали!
Команда мрії: хто такі “агенти” та чому вони важливі
Ви, напевно, пам’ятаєте мої попередні відео, де я розповідала про різницю між “звичайними” голосовими помічниками (як Siri чи Alexa) та “агентними” ШІ. Перші – наче консьєрж у готелі: ви запитуєте, вони відповідають. Другі – менеджери, які можуть щось зробити для вас, а не лише відповісти на питання.
Але сьогодні ми підемо далі. Поговоримо про “оркестраторів” – агентів, що диригують оркестром інших агентів. Уявіть головного менеджера проєкту, який знає, хто з його команди чим займається, як все це об’єднати, щоб проєкт завершився вчасно та якісно.
Коли багато таких “робочих конячок” ШІ співпрацюють над одним завданням, ми маємо справу з так званою багатоагентною системою (multi-agent system). Це може бути як централізоване управління, де один “шеф” роздає завдання, так і ієрархічна структура, подібна до справжньої компанії з начальниками відділів. Але сьогодні ми зосередимося на тому, як вони працюють разом, коли запускається процес.
Сценарій: подячні листи для команди
Візьмемо приклад, щоб уявити це в дії. Уявіть, ви на роботі, і вам потрібно написати персоналізовані подячні листи всім, хто допомагав з останнім проєктом. Це завдання ви ставите своєму “оркестратор-агенту”.
“Привіт, Орк! Потрібна твоя допомога. Напиши, будь ласка, персоналізовані подячні листи членам моєї команди, які допомагали з нашим останнім проєктом”.
Ваше запитання потрапило до системи, і якщо все налаштовано правильно (тобто, орк-агент готовий, API для доступу до даних підключені, а послідовність виконання завдань визначена), починається справжнє диво.
Крок перший: вибираємо правильних “музикантів”
Перше – вибір агентів. Це, мабуть, найзнайоміша вам частина, якщо ви дивилися мої попередні відео. Уявіть, що Орк відкриває каталог своїх колег – різних агентів та інструментів – і шукає тих, хто найкраще підійде для завдання.
У нашому випадку, з написанням подяк, Орк може подумати: “Потрібен доступ до інформації про проєкт, хто брав участь та їхній внесок. Потім – агент, що вміє гарно писати тексти, можливо, навіть з певним тоном подяки. І, зрештою, потрібно це якось надіслати, можливо, через корпоративний додаток для заохочення співробітників”.
Отже, для завдання Орк вибере:
- Систему управління проєктами: де міститься вся історія, хто що робив.
- Агента для генерації електронних листів/текстів: щоб написати самі подяки.
- Додаток для заохочення співробітників: щоб швидко та елегантно надіслати листи.
Крок другий: розподіляємо ноти (і завдання)
Далі йде координація робочого процесу. Орк розбиває велике завдання (написати подяки) на менші підзавдання і розподіляє їх між обраними агентами. Також він використовує API (інтерфейси програмування додатків) для з’єднання цих систем, щоб отримати необхідні дані.
– “Агент Управління Проєктами, надай список тих, хто працював над проєктом X, та їхню роль”, – каже він.
– “Агент Генерації Текстів, я дам тобі ці списки та загальний тон подяки, а ти створиш чернетку кожного листа”, – додає він.
– “Агент Додатку для Заохочень, будь готовий прийняти готові тексти і розіслати їх людям, яких я вкажу”.
І ось тут починається магія взаємодії.
Крок третій: спільний стіл з даними
Коли кожен агент виконав свою частину, вони надсилають інформацію назад Орк-агенту. Це як готувати спільну вечерю: кожен приносить страву, а потім всі сідають за стіл.
Орк отримує інформацію про членів команди, їхній внесок, генерує чернетки подяк, і, можливо, навіть отримує список електронних адрес для надсилання.
Цікаво знати: Важливо розуміти, що під час роботи агенти обмінюються контекстом. Орк-агент підтримує зв’язок між усіма “під-агентами” в реальному часі, щоб ніхто не втратив нитку.
А тепер зупинимося. Ви, як користувач, знаєте, що сьогодні багато різних інструментів від різних розробників. Часто вони працюють по-різному, написані різними мовами програмування. Що робити, якщо інформація, яка нам потрібна, знаходиться в системі, розробленій в іншій компанії, і не “зрозуміла” ту, яку використовує ваш Орк-агент?
Саме для цього випадку існує MCP – Model Context Protocol. Уявіть собі це як універсальний USB-C порт для ваших ШІ-додатків.
- M (Model) – стосується моделі, тобто великої мовної моделі, що лежить в основі вашого агента.
- C (Context) – вся додаткова інформація, яка потрібна для виконання завдання: документи, результати пошуку, дані із зовнішніх систем.
- P (Protocol) – стандартизований спосіб спілкування, який дозволяє моделі взаємодіяти з різними інструментами та джерелами даних, незалежно від того, хто їх створив і як вони працюють.
Іншими словами, MCP дозволяє агенту запитати: “Дай інформацію про Х”, – і не турбуватися про те, де саме ця інформація зберігається або як її отримати. Це як попросити бібліотекаря знайти книгу, не знаючи, на якій полиці вона стоїть.
Крок четвертий: збираємо “врожай”
Після всього цього, результат роботи пакується в так званий артефакт. Це, власне, готовий продукт, результат вашого завдання.
Орк-агент генерує фінальні версії подяк для кожного члена вашої команди. І, щоб зробити вашу роботу ще простішою, він може навіть запитати: “Хочеш, я надішлю ці листи автоматично через додаток для заохочень?”.
Ви, просто відповідаєте “Так, будь ласка, дякую!” і отримуєте підтвердження, що листи відправлено. Нікуди не потрібно переходити, нічого не потрібно робити. Це вражає!
Завжди вчимося: що далі?
Але це ще не все! Останній етап процесу – безперервне навчання. Агенти, як і люди, аналізують свою роботу. Орк-агент моніторить, наскільки успішно виконані завдання, чи задоволені “замовники” (ви, ваші колеги), і вносить корективи на майбутнє.
Якщо він помітив, що подяки були занадто загальними, або тон не зовсім той, він запам’ятає це і наступного разу спробує зробити краще. Це як вчитись готувати борщ: перший раз, можливо, не ідеально, але з кожним разом – смачніше.
Запам’ятайте: Оркестратор-агенти – не просто зручний інструмент. Вони є ключовим елементом сучасних багатоагентних систем. Вони допомагають:
- Підбирати правильних “спеціалістів” для завдання.
- Координувати складні робочі процеси.
- Безшовно отримувати доступ до даних завдяки таким протоколам, як MCP.
- Постійно вдосконалюватися, навчаючись на власному досвіді.
Що далі, коли ШІ працює за вас?
Наступного разу, коли будете використовувати ШІ для виконання завдання, спробуйте уявити, що за лаштунками працює ціла команда. І замість того, щоб самостійно “наглядати” за кожним кроком, довірте цю місію “оркестратору”. Це дозволить не лише заощадити час, а й зробити процеси набагато ефективнішими.
Відверто кажучи, колись я теж думала, що ШІ – це просто інструмент, який потрібно “змушувати” працювати. Але коли я почала розбиратися в тому, як працюють багатоагентні системи та оркестрація, моє уявлення змінилося. Це як відкрити двері до нової ери співпраці між людиною та машиною.
І найцікавіше, що це тільки початок. Технології розвиваються з космічною швидкістю, і хто знає, які ще дива чекають на нас попереду? Можливо, одного дня ваш ШІ-помічник зможе не тільки написати подяки, а й організувати вечірку на честь вашого проєкту!
Підсумовуючи, сучасний штучний інтелект – це складні системи, де різні компоненти взаємодіють і співпрацюють. Оркестратор-агенти є серцем цих систем, забезпечуючи ефективне виконання завдань.
А як ви думаєте, які ще завдання ви хотіли б довірити своїй багатоагентній системі ШІ? Напишіть у коментарях!
Можливо, ви захочете спробувати налаштувати власного агента або дослідити можливості MCP. Це може бути цікавою пригодою! Головне – не бійтеся експериментувати та відкривати для себе нові горизонти, які дає нам світ технологій.







